Post by: ILLusions0fGrander on June 07, 2006, 10:46:00 PM
ripkit available.. rips nothing to ruin the game... flipping sweet...
id post the rip, but i dont know how xbox-scene feels about links to that site.

how i got it to work:
prx files taken from battlefront, and renamed into all UPPERCASE, even the .PRX, as they are in cell.

ripped to files using UMDgen, replaced prx files, used rip kit to shrink it down to ~800MB, made ISO with VCDrom 3.6, devhook .041 on 333mhz mode, and rest of the settings as stated in readme.

Post by: ILLusions0fGrander on June 08, 2006, 08:47:00 PM
mine froze there too.. you need prx files from street riders and battlefront.

dont ask where to get these files

edit: tutorial i wrote



QUOTE

extract all files from cell ISO
get prx files here
link removed

prx's all renamed UPPERCASE, even the .PRX just add them to the
PSP_GAME\USRDIR\SYSTEM\PSP_MODULES folder

use ripkit

use VCDromx 3.6 to build your ISO

load up Devhook .41 with these settings:

select CELL.iso or whatever you named it
UMD mount: ISO anydvd
UMD version 2.xx
firmware 2.5+2.00
CPU clock 333mhz
reboot XMB

!!! for some reason, the realtime cut scenes go really fast and its impossible to see whats going on. !!!
